Defining the UCSC-DVD-C240M6= in Cisco’s Server Ecosystem

The ​​UCSC-DVD-C240M6=​​ is a specialized optical drive kit designed for Cisco’s UCS C240 M6 rack servers, specifically engineered to support ​​firmware updates​​, ​​OS installations​​, and ​​legacy media dependencies​​ in enterprise environments. As a critical component for server lifecycle management, this DVD drive kit addresses the persistent need for physical media access in modern data centers constrained by security protocols or air-gapped networks.


Hardware Integration and Compatibility

​Physical Specifications​

  • ​Form Factor​​: Slimline 9.5mm SATA DVD±RW drive
  • ​Interface​​: SATA III 6Gbps with hot-swappable tray
  • ​Mounting​​: Tool-less 2U bezel integration into C240 M6 front bays
  • ​Power Draw​​: 1.8W idle, 3.5W active

​Certified Compatibility​​:

  • Cisco UCS C240 M6 SFF/LFF configurations
  • VMware ESXi 7.0/8.0 ISO validation
  • Red Hat Enterprise Linux 8.6+ Secure Boot

​Performance Metrics​​:

  • ​Write Speed​​: 8x DVD±R, 6x DVD±RW
  • ​Read Speed​​: 16x DVD-ROM
  • ​MTBF​​: 100,000 hours under 35°C ambient

Core Deployment Scenarios

​1. Air-Gapped Security Environments​

In classified government or financial infrastructures prohibiting internet connectivity, the UCSC-DVD-C240M6= enables:

  • ​Offline firmware updates​​ for BIOS/CIMC using Cisco-signed ISO packages
  • ​Secure OS provisioning​​ without external USB ports
  • ​Audit trail creation​​ via write-once media for compliance

​2. Legacy Application Support​

Healthcare and manufacturing sectors requiring CD/DVD-based software benefit from:

  • ​Backward compatibility​​ with ISO 9660 and UDF 1.5 file systems
  • ​Persistent device recognition​​ in Windows Server 2012 R2/2016
  • ​RAID 1 redundancy​​ when paired with Cisco FlexFlash SD cards

​3. Disaster Recovery Operations​

Field technicians use this drive for:

  • ​Bare-metal restores​​ from disaster recovery DVDs
  • ​Diagnostic toolkit execution​​ (Cisco UCS Boot Optimized Storage Solution)
  • ​Driver repository access​​ during network outages

Installation and Configuration Best Practices

​Hardware Integration​

  1. ​Bay Allocation​​: Install in front bay 11-12 (dedicated optical slots) to avoid storage backplane conflicts
  2. ​Cabling​​: Use Cisco-certified SATA cables (UCS-240CBLMR12=) to prevent signal degradation
  3. ​Firmware Syncing​​: Match drive firmware to server BIOS version via Cisco Host Upgrade Utility

​Software Optimization​

  • ​VMware Auto Deploy​​: Configure PXE-less ESXi installations through virtual media redirection
  • ​Secure Boot Workflows​​: Validate SHA-256 checksums for UEFI-bootable DVDs
  • ​Media Retention​​: Implement 7-year archival policy for audit-compliant backups

Troubleshooting Common Operational Issues

​Media Recognition Failures​

  • ​Root Cause​​: Incompatible UDF formats or scratched discs
  • ​Solution​​:
    • Use ​​Cisco UCS Driver Update Utility​​ to create verified media
    • Enable ​​CIMC Virtual Media​​ as fallback

​Performance Degradation​

  • ​Root Cause​​: Thermal throttling in dense racks
  • ​Mitigation​​:
    • Maintain ​​front intake temps <40°C​
    • Schedule intensive writes during off-peak hours
